First it should be mentioned that we will learn two methods to remove vba password from ms excel. How to break vba password in excel 2016 20 2010 2007 2003. Vba code, vbaproject, file extension, and an excel password recovery tool. The new created workbook should be saved as a workbook that supports macros i. If you have an xlsm formatted file, you maybe be able to simply save the file as an xls format using excel and breach the file with this method. I set the password on the vba project and forgot it. Xlsm files are same as xlsx files but you need to enable the macros to make xlsm files to xlsx. It was tested on the workbooks created in excel 20072010. Crack vba macro password in excel 2007 worksheets systools. The password for the vba code will simply be 1234 as in the example im showing here.
I have a simple file with only one simple macro i noticed that the file, for some reason, had been changed to. Closing workbook causes vba project password prompt to appear. Beberapa waktu lalu telah saya posting tentang cara unprotect sheet microsoft excel tanpa password yang menggunakan kode script. One of my employees has left the company suddenly and i need some of his files, which are being password protected. If this solution doesnt work, try removing password from vba project online title. Also remove the protection of any regularly protected vba project. The following steps illustrate how you can crack the excel vba project password by simply changing the file extension.
A common request across the excel forums is looking for some way to remove a password from the worksheetworkbookvba project. Save the vba project binary file and close it step 5 come back and zip it again with any naming convention but with extension. Unfortunately, the properties of the source vba project, including its password, cannot be transferred to the target workbook. Macro works by the algorithm described in my previous post, so in fact it changes any password in vba project to macro. Xlib includes around 120 functions, is very small in size around 60 kb, and is written in pure vba, so you can easily add it to your office file by simply copying and pasting the.
Excel password recovers all excel password types and supports all excel versions including excel 2007. This article will introduce 4 ways to recover excel password and unlock. How to break vba password in excel 2016, 20, 2010, 2007 or 2003 easily. In the macro window, do not expand the project, go to tools vba project properties on the protection tab, set a password of your choice and leave the checkbox selected. Hence, though developers apply visual basic application password to prevent access to the passcode of the vba macro, it is possible to crack vba project password in excel 2007 worksheet and workbook.
Learn how to remove password from vba projects in excel 20. Currently only excel 2007 and excel 2010 use this file type. Stuck with an excel vba document thats locked with a password. Let me share some of the methods i use to crack excel passwords. But i cant even get to the file to use a macro, because as soon as i open it, there is a dialog asking for a password, and if i click on cancel, the file doesnt even open. Now, open the excel file you need to see the vba code in. Thus, the code embedded in the newly copied worksheet will be visible, even if the source vba project was password locked or custom. This method can be applied to an excel 2003 xls file, so, if you have an excel 2007 xlsm file you can simply save it in the previous. Open the xlsm file with 7 zip right click 7zip open archive. Also explore the best solutions for breaking password of vba project in excel. Find out reliable method to unlock vba code password into excel. When you run the reset vba password a command, a file dialog appears where you can select the file you want to unprotect. Create a new xlsm file and store this code in module1.
How to bypass excel vba project password accepted answer on. If this solution doesnt work, try removing password from vba project online s. Recheck the lock project for viewing checkbox and add your own memorable password. With that mindset, heres the file i use for cracking passwords. I personally dont understand how it works, but think its some kind of memory trick that lets you. The vba editor then opens and, sure enough, all vba is stripped out from modules and worksheets. Excel tool vba password recovery free downloads and. Now focus here, if you lost your vba password and you are looking for a manual solution to crack the password.
Open the file you want to crack with your hex editor and paste the above copied lines from the dummy file. Rightclick the vba project name, select properties, go to the protection tab and delete the existing passwords as well as uncheck the lock project for viewing checkbox. First backup the excel file you dont know the vba password for, then open it with your hex editor, and paste the above copied lines from the dummy file. The remainder of this post only covers the xlsx, xlsm and xlam file formats. Make a backup of the file where the vba project is passwordprotected. If you are working on xlsm file, then save this file in. Open the xlsm file with 7zip right click 7zip open archive copy the xlvbaproject. The 7 byte length is the odd one, and if this happens when you create your file with the 1234 password, just create another file, and it should jump to the 143 byte length.
If you try to paste the wrong number of bytes into the file, you will lose your vba project when you try to open the file with excel. Moreover, when it is tried to expand the project it prompts for a password. Start a new excel file and switch to the vba project editor. When expanding the vba project, the user is presented with a box to enter the password. Although the process is lengthy, you can follow it keenly to crack your excel vba password eventually. Vba project passwords prevent users from viewing or changing the code of a. What to do when you dont remember word excel vba project. Hello rvba, today i wanted to share my free and opensource vba function library, xlib. You can help protect yourself from scammers by verifying that the contact is a microsoft agent or microsoft employee and that the phone number is an official microsoft global customer service number. How to recover password on a xlsm file, which changed. On the web we can find a lot of software for free which do that but they have limitations and you have to pay to crack longer passwords, but we can crack a vba password editing the file using an hex editor. Ms excel 2007 creates xlsx file by default whereas it forms xlsm file when macros are enabled.
You can try this direct vba approach which doesnt require hex editing. Remove vba password instantly removes any vba password and unlocks locked vba projects in almost any type of file. How to bypass the vba project password from excel super user. Ok your way out and now the vba code is accessible. The manual method can be performed with the help of hex editor. While there is no way to retrieve it from the project file, there is a way to crack it so you can reset it with a new password.
In the visual basic editor, navigate to tools vbaproject properties. Is there a way to crack the password on an excel vba project. I was working on my school project and set password on my vba project. The manual method to remove vba project password performed by the user.
Closing workbook causes vba project password prompt to appear if certain trigger conditions are met on the affected file, the vba password prompt pops up after closing the workbook. I would like to present a simple macro in a form of. Open the xlsm file with 7zip right click 7zip open archive. It supports microsoft office excel, word, powerpoint, access, publisher, outlook. Crack excel vba password xlsm vs xlsx crack excel vba password xlsm to xls. It is more complicated than the above methods, and it requires a vba basis. Only suitable for password recovery for older versions of worksheet. How to break xlsb password for the whole file, not sheet. How to bypassremove excel vba project password accepted answer on stackoverflow this accepted answer got nearly. If something goes wrong with the steps below, you can always trash the one you tried to crack and make a new copy. In the above discussion, major problem faced by the users, i.
Regain access to your valuable excel worksheets and workbooks that were protected by an excel 2007 or 2010 program. Get easy and simple method to remove vba password from excel 20. One will allow you to access excel document saved to the older format xls and the second solution will allow you to remove the password protection from xlsx file. Tech support scams are an industrywide issue where scammers trick you into paying for unnecessary technical support services. How to unlock protected excel vba project and macro codes. Take note, putting a password on any of these items does not make it secure, it only slows someone down from messing things up. Open the files that contain your locked vba projects. Broadly classifying, the method to remove vba project password excel 20 is very easy. These scripting programs allow automating the majority of routine office tasks and make the office a better place. Follow the below steps to recover your vba password. The files are needed urgently, so we had tried some solutions to open vba excel 20 file but didnt get.
A proper solution is discussed, which helps to give systematic guidance to the users. Change the file format of the macroenabled workbook from xlsm to zip. Select the protection tab, tick the lock project for viewing, enter and confirm a password, then click ok. Let us now see how excel stores this data in the file. How to crack the vba password on an excel project work. The new workbook has its own vba project, which is unlocked at the time of creation. Excel unlocking an excel vba project developers hut. You may also want to know, xlsm files are zip files. Vba password cracking using hxd hex editor software create a backup of the file at a safe location. Image titled open a password protected excel file step 1.